Hepatitis C, Chronic
Conditions
Brief summary
This 2 arm study will assess the efficacy and safety of PEGASYS plus COPEGUS, with or without concomitant pioglitazone, on hepatitis C virus titers in treatment-naive patients with genotype 1 chronic hepatitis C, and insulin resistance. Patients will be randomized to receive either a)PEGASYS 180 micrograms/week + Copegus 1000-1600 mg/day (according to body weight) for 48 weeks or b)16 weeks of pioglitazone (30 mg daily for 8 weeks, then 45 mg daily for 8 weeks), followed by PEGASYS 180 micrograms/week + Copegus 1000-1600 mg/day + pioglitazone 45 mg daily for 48 weeks. The anticipated time on study treatment is 1-2 years, and the target sample size is 100-500 individuals.

Eligibility
Inclusion criteria
* adult patients, \>=18 years of age; * chronic hepatitis C, genotype 1; * insulin resistance.
Exclusion criteria
* other forms of liver disease; * cirrhosis; * previous treatment for chronic hepatitis C; * insulin treatment during prior 2 weeks; * type 1 diabetes.

Participant flow
Pre-assignment details
Patients randomized to the pioglitazone arm participated in a 16-week pioglitazone run-in (Week -16 to Week 0) prior to beginning anti-HCV therapy: PEG-INF alpha-2a \[Pegasys\] plus ribavarin \[Copegus\]. Patients randomized to the without pioglitazone arm started anti-HCV therapy immediately.
Participants by arm
| Arm | Count |
|---|---|
| PEG-INF Alpha-2a + Ribavirin+ Pioglitazone Participants received pioglitazone in a 16 week run-in period (30 mg per day orally for 8 weeks followed by 45 mg per day orally for 8 weeks). Participants then received pioglitazone 45 mg daily orally plus 18 μg of Peginterferon Alfa-2a (PEG-INF alpha-2a)\[Pegasys\] subcutaneous (sc) once a week plus ribavirin \[Copegus\] (1000 - 1600 mg/day orally as a split dose in the morning and the evening based on the participant's body weight) for 48 weeks in the anti-HCV treatment phase. Participants received 45 mg of pioglitazone per day orally in the 24 week follow-up period. | 77 |
| PEG-INF Alpha-2a + Ribavirin Participants received 18 μg of Peginterferon Alfa-2a (PEG-INF alpha-2a)\[Pegasys\] subcutaneous (sc) once a week plus ribavirin \[Copegus\] (1000 - 1600 mg/day orally as a split dose in the morning and the evening based on the participant's body weight) for 48 weeks in the anti-HCV treatment phase followed by a treatment free 24 week follow-up period. | 73 |
| Total | 150 |

Percentage of Nonresponders During the 48 Week Anti-HCV Treatment Period
Nonresponders are defined as patients who did not achieve undetectable HCV RNA during anti-HCV treatment
Time frame: Up to 48 Weeks
Population: Intent-to Treat population includes all randomized patients who received at least one dose of study drug and had at least one post-randomization HCV RNA assessment. Patients with missing HCV RNA values are considered as non-responders.
| Arm | Measure | Value (NUMBER) |
|---|---|---|
| PEG-INF Alpha-2a + Ribavirin+ Pioglitazone | Percentage of Nonresponders During the 48 Week Anti-HCV Treatment Period | 45.5 Percentage of Participants |
| PEG-INF Alpha-2a + Ribavirin | Percentage of Nonresponders During the 48 Week Anti-HCV Treatment Period | 30.1 Percentage of Participants |

Percentage of Participants With a Virological Relapse at Week 72 (24 Weeks After the End of Anti-HCV Treatment)
Virologic relapse was defined as the reappearance of HCV-RNA in serum after PEG-INF alpha 2a therapy is discontinued in a patient who was HCV-RNA undetectable at the completion of anti-HCV therapy.
Time frame: Week 72
Population: Intent-to Treat population includes all randomized patients who received at least one dose of study drug and had at least one post-randomization HCV RNA assessment. Patients with missing HCV RNA values are considered as non-responders.
| Arm | Measure | Value (NUMBER) |
|---|---|---|
| PEG-INF Alpha-2a + Ribavirin+ Pioglitazone | Percentage of Participants With a Virological Relapse at Week 72 (24 Weeks After the End of Anti-HCV Treatment) | 15.6 Percentage of Participants |
| PEG-INF Alpha-2a + Ribavirin | Percentage of Participants With a Virological Relapse at Week 72 (24 Weeks After the End of Anti-HCV Treatment) | 19.2 Percentage of Participants |
